Evelyn Hanshaw Middle operates as a reasonably sized middle-grades school in Modesto, California, one of the schools within Modesto City Elementary. Current enrollment sits at 650 students spanning grades 7 through 8.
Modesto City Elementary runs 26 schools in total, collectively educating 14,444 students. Evelyn Hanshaw Middle is one of those campuses.
In terms of who attends, Evelyn Hanshaw Middle records that 88%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. Beyond that, the school records 4% multiracial, 3% White, 3% Asian. The wider county runs roughly 50% Hispanic, putting the school's mix visibly more Hispanic than the area baseline.
On the resource side, Staff filings list 33 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 19.8:1 students per teacher. The state averages around 20.7: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. About 93%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. By comparison, Stanislaus County runs at roughly 71%, so the school's eligibility rate is above the surrounding baseline.
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, Evelyn Hanshaw Middle s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 23.9%; this one delivers 19.1%.
In the broader community, the surrounding county (Stanislaus County) shows that the typical household earns roughly $81,468 per year, roughly 20%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 11% of residents live below the federal poverty line. In all, Stanislaus County runs 190 public schools (combined enrollment of about 106,477 students), of which Evelyn Hanshaw Middle is one.
Bret Harte Elementary is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.2 miles from this campus.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. On composite proficiency, Evelyn Hanshaw Middle comes 4th of 7 in the immediate cluster, behind the nearby-schools average of 20.7%.
Evelyn Hanshaw Middle operates from a high-density location.
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count shrank 26%: 876 students in 2018 compared to 650 in 2025. Class-load math has narrowed: from 23.0:1 in 2018 to 19.8:1 in 2025.
